Thursday 3rd September to 8th October 2026

6:15PM-9:00PM

Join me in my spacious studio for an in-depth beginner's sewing class! During this course, I will take you through everything involved in becoming comfortable with a sewing machine, working on smaller samples whilst progressing towards making a garment made to your measurements. The choice of garment includes a t-shirt (unisex), a tunic top/dress (plus sizing available) and a pinafore dress (plus sizing available). 


There's no need to have your own machine as they will be provided-with the option to bring your own if you have one at home you'd like to get to grips with. All materials are included except the fabric/trims/thread for your final garment-which I'll give you tips for choosing yourself!



Ideal for beginners with little/no experience, as well as people already familiar with the basics of a sewing machine looking to build their skills and move on to garment making. My mini/accessories course also provides a great full introduction before moving on to my clothes making class.



Class sizes will be small to ensure good one on one time. I will provide all equipment needed for the class-scissors, pins etc. An optional list of supplies that would be helpful for working on your skills/project at home will also be sent upon enrollment. I will also send you the choice of sewing patterns available so you can choose the garment you will be making for your final project. The sewing pattern will be yours to take away after class.




Course content includes:


Learning the ins and outs of a sewing machine
Threading a machine
Using a commercial sewing pattern
Sewing buttons and zips
Essential sewing techniques
Tracing off pattern pieces
Measuring and choosing a pattern size
Marking pattern pieces on fabric
Cutting fabric
Choosing fabrics for a project
Finishing techniques
